Clara Rugaard, the Danish actress who starred in Netflix’s I Am Mother, is to lead the cast for Sky’s The Rising, a supernatural crime thriller that was originally inspired by Belgian drama Hotel Beau Séjour.
Deadline first revealed in October 2019 that Sky was making its own version of Hotel Beau Séjour, and the drama is now poised to shoot in the Lake District, England, next month. The eight-part series represents the first Sky drama produced entirely in-house by Sky Studios.

Kim Kardashian has denied claims that she attempted to import a "looted and smuggled" Ancient Roman sculpture. A report by Artnet alleges that the Keeping Up With The Kardashians star purchased the limestone antique from Axel Vervoordt Gallery in Belgium in 2016.
